JavaScript 停止工作的解决方法

2025-01-10 18:38:56   小编

JavaScript停止工作的解决方法

在网页开发过程中,JavaScript停止工作是一个常见且令人头疼的问题。不过,只要掌握正确的排查思路和解决方法,就能快速让代码恢复正常运行。

语法错误是导致JavaScript停止工作的常见原因之一。JavaScript对语法要求较为严格,哪怕一个小的标点符号错误,都可能使代码无法正常运行。在现代浏览器中,开发者工具提供了强大的错误检测功能。以Chrome浏览器为例,打开开发者工具(快捷键F12),切换到“控制台”选项卡。当页面中的JavaScript代码存在语法错误时,控制台会明确指出错误的位置和类型。比如“Uncaught SyntaxError: Unexpected token '}'”,这就提示我们在某个位置的花括号可能存在配对问题。仔细检查报错行及附近代码,修正语法错误,往往能解决JavaScript停止工作的问题。

脚本加载顺序也是一个关键因素。如果JavaScript脚本依赖于某些HTML元素,但在这些元素尚未加载完成时脚本就开始执行,就会导致找不到相应元素,进而使代码停止工作。解决这个问题有几种方法。一种是将脚本标签放在HTML文档的底部,确保所有的HTML元素都已加载完成后再执行JavaScript代码。另一种方法是使用DOMContentLoaded事件。例如:

document.addEventListener('DOMContentLoaded', function() {
    // 在这里编写你的代码
});

这样,代码会在页面的DOM结构加载完成后才执行,避免了因元素未加载而导致的问题。

冲突问题也可能导致JavaScript停止工作。当页面中引入多个JavaScript库或脚本时,可能会出现命名冲突或版本不兼容的情况。解决冲突问题,可以采用模块化开发的方式,将不同的功能封装在独立的模块中,避免全局变量的冲突。确保所使用的库和脚本版本相互兼容,并及时更新到最新的稳定版本。

通过仔细排查语法错误、合理调整脚本加载顺序以及解决潜在的冲突问题,大部分JavaScript停止工作的情况都能得到有效解决,确保网页的交互功能正常运行。

TAGS: JavaScript调试方法 JavaScript修复策略 JavaScript预防措施

欢迎使用万千站长工具!

Welcome to www.zzTool.com